Ghost Immobiliser - Protect Your Vehicle From Auto Thieves
A ghost immobiliser helps protect your vehicle from auto thieves. It's low-cost and simple to install. It connects to the CAN bus and is controlled by your ECU (engine control unit).
It generates an unique PIN code that you need to enter before you start your vehicle. It can be used in conjunction with other tracking devices and car alarm systems to create an effective security against thieves.

The greatest benefit of ghost immobilisers is that you can mount it on your car without leaving any marks. This will help keep your vehicle's value and interior in good condition. It connects with the CAN system of your vehicle and utilizes electronic buttons on your dashboard or steering wheel, as well as on your door panels to create a unique PIN you must enter before you can start your vehicle. This is like a password on a computer, and it can contain up to 20 characters, making it almost impossible to bypass.
This kind of security can also be used on a variety of vehicles. It can be put in on cars, motorbikes and even on lawn mowers with ride-on capabilities. It is also effective against jamming signals as well as key cloning, device spoofing and other methods used by thieves to bypass security measures.

The device generates a unique pin code needed to begin the vehicle. This can be set to any length, and is changed by the owner at any time. The device is then connected to the existing interface of your vehicle, such as the steering wheel, the centre console, or the door cards. The system will be able to recognize any attempts to start the engine using another key or fob and will issue an emergency PIN to the person who is using it via their smartphone.
This is a great deterrent to thieves who try to replicate or hack your car's keys. They won't be able start the car without the correct pin code. This is a fantastic tool that can be used alongside a tracker device to help locate your vehicle in the case of theft.
The ghost immobiliser is also an effective method to deter thieves, as it detects any vibrations within or around your car. This can be an indication that someone is trying to steal it and could cause the system to notify the owner's mobile phone.
When you need to dispose of your vehicle for cleaning or servicing the device can be turned into "service valet" mode. This feature can be activated by a pin code and is easy to enable when you return to your vehicle. You can now confidently transfer your car to a valet, or a transport company, knowing that the vehicle will be protected against any unintentional activities. The Autowatch Ghost II can immobiliser is also capable of being placed into "service transport mode" when you want to drive your vehicle from one garage to another for an MOT, service or any other reason.

The Ghost Immobiliser is a highly effective and reliable anti-theft system that works in a very simple way. It communicates with the vehicle's ECU on the data circuit CAN, which generates a unique PIN code which must be entered in order for your vehicle to begin. The device doesn't emit radio signals, like traditional immobilisers. This makes it difficult for thieves and others to detect or disable the system. Instead, it requires an PIN code that is entered via the existing buttons on your dashboard or the steering wheel.

Easy to Install

Ghost immobilisers add an additional layer to your security system, preventing tech-savvy thieves from copying your vehicle and stealing it. It works by making it difficult for criminals to open your car, even though you have the keys. It uses buttons inside your vehicle, like the ones on your steering wheel and the centre console, to generate an individual sequence of pin codes that need to be entered in order to start your vehicle. This means that if you've got a ghost system fitted only you are able to drive your pride and joy.
The device is tiny, and it can be hidden in a variety of places. It does not have any LED indicators or keyfobs so it will be difficult to spot by potential thieves. It is also tamper proof and only activated with your personal PIN code. You can alter the code at any time and it's a great option to safeguard your vehicle from hackers and thieves who may be planning to steal or clone your vehicle.
Installation of the device is a specialised process that should only be done by a qualified professional. The Ghost 2 is wired into the CAN bus system of the vehicle, so that it can communicate directly with the ECU. It is compatible with all vehicles, from automobiles to motorhomes and vans. It can be used even on electric motors-powered vehicles like ride-on mowers.
The first step in installing the Ghost immobiliser is to locate an energy source that will ensure a continuous supply of 12V. Then, you can use the wiring diagram to locate the CAN High and CAN Low wires inside your vehicle. Strip a small piece of each wire with a stripper. Label the wires using labels or tape to make it easier to distinguish them during installation.
Connect the CAN H wires and CAN L to the engine control unit of your vehicle. Solder or use high-quality connectors to ensure a tight connection. Use cable ties to tie the wires and connect them. Finally, double-check the wire connections to ensure that they are insulated and solid.
